About

Navigate the Alaska Native Health Campus with turn-by-turn directions to buildings, parking, and points of interest. Find COVID-19 clinics and track shuttle locations directly from your mobile device.

Turn-by-turn campus navigation
Find providers and points of interest
Locate parking
COVID-19 clinic finder
Shuttle tracking

What is Tinitun?

Tinitun is a free mobile application designed to help users navigate the Alaska Native Health Campus. It provides turn-by-turn directions, helps locate points of interest, and offers information on health services.

What devices does Tinitun support?

Tinitun is available for iPhone, iPad, and iPod devices, allowing for convenient access on Apple mobile products.

How accurate is Tinitun's navigation?

The app offers turn-by-turn directions for key areas of the Alaska Native Health Campus, including specific buildings and general campus navigation, aiming to provide precise guidance.

Can Tinitun help me find health services?

Yes, Tinitun can assist in finding COVID-19 vaccination and testing clinics, as well as locating providers and other points of interest on campus.
